Multiple Gravity Assist Interplanetary Trajectories

Multiple Gravity Assist Interplanetary Trajectories PDF Author: OV Papkov

Reflecting the results of twenty years; experience in the field of multipurpose flights, this monograph includes the complex routes of the trajectories of a number of bodies (e.g., space vehicles, comets) in the solar system. A general methodological approach to the research of flight schemes and the choice of optimal performances is developed. Additionally, a number of interconnected methods and algorithms used at sequential stages of such development are introduced, which allow the selection of a rational multipurpose route for a space vehicle, the design of multipurpose orbits, the determination of optimal space vehicle design, and ballistic performances for carrying out the routes chosen. Other topics include the practical results obtained from using these methods, navigation problems, near-to-planet orbits, and an overview of proven and new flight schemes.

Advances in Space Science and Technology, Volume 3 presents the development in space science and space technology. This book considers the engineering problems applicable to the attainment of astronautical objectives and examines a critical aspect of manned space flight. Organized into eight chapters, this volume begins with an overview of the role of geology in lunar exploration programs. This text then discusses the preliminary considerations of Venus as an astronautical objective. Other chapters consider a schematic representation of the positions of the Sun, Earth, Mars, and Venus at the approximate times of closest approach of the latter two planets to Earth. This book demonstrates as well that a fuller understanding of each individual body will contribute much to an over-all understanding of the nature and history of the Solar System itself. The final chapter deals with the phenomenon of weightlessness associated with orbital flight. This book is a valuable resource for astronomers, scientists, and engineers.

Medical and Biological Problems of Space Flight covers the proceedings of the conference held in Nassau, the Bahamas. The book focuses on the biological and medical problems of space flight, as well as advanced manned space systems, cardiovascular adaptability, weightlessness, and remote visual monitoring. The selection first offers information on the development of manned space vehicles and advanced manned space systems, including manned satellite and space stations, safety considerations, and man-machine aspects. The book also takes a look at Marsflight II space cabin simulator and device for simulating weightlessness. Discussions focus on the psychological aspects of real and simulated weightlessness; physiological effects of real and simulated weightlessness; and critique of simulation excellence. The publication examines maintenance of cardiovascular adaptability during prolonged weightlessness and the physical, biological, and medical aspects of weightlessness. The text then ponders on remote visual monitoring during extended space missions and cosmic ray shower production in manned space vehicles. Topics include electron-proton showers and limitations imposed by communications on transmission of pictorial information from a space vehicle. The selection is a valuable reference for readers interested in the medical and biological problems of space flight.
